Are portable induction cooktops safe for home use?
Yes, they are among the safest cooking methods since the surface stays cool to the touch, preventing burns, and they shut off automatically without cookware. Family Handyman highlights their child-safe design and energy savings, making them perfect for small spaces or RVs.
How do I choose the right size heating coil for my needs?
Opt for 6.5-8 inch coils for versatility with various pot sizes; larger ones like in Nuwave or ChangBERT models handle bigger pans better for family meals. Bob Vila recommends matching coil size to your most-used cookware for optimal efficiency.
Can induction cooktops work with all cookware?
No, they require ferromagnetic materials like cast iron or stainless steel; test with a magnet. This Old House suggests adapters for non-compatible pans, but sticking to induction-ready sets ensures best performance. For cooling solutions in hot kitchens, see our best window air conditioners.
